The hexadecimal color code #29FBEE corresponds to the code RGB( 41, 251, 238 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,16 level), green (at 0,98 level) and blue (at 0,93 level). Its brightness is 57% and its saturation is 96%. It is composed of red at 7%, green at 47% and blue at 44%.
